The Cranley brings together the best of established hotel tradition
and service, plus the advantages of the most up-to-date technology expected
from a top-class London hotel of the 21st century. Furnished with wonderful
antiques, The Cranley has an understated elegance and air of sophistication.
The colours used throughout the hotel rooms and reception areas, striking
combinations of Chinese blue. mustard, plum and stone, are derived from
the original 19th-century floor tiles in the hotel's entrance hall.

Accommodation - A number of rooms boast elegant, king-size four-poster
beds, whilst the majority are furnished with equally dramatic half-tester
canopied beds. However, you will be glad to know that we have dispensed
with Victorian horse-hair mattresses in favour of luxurious sprung mattresses.
Curtains and bed hangings are natural linen whilst the headboards and valances
are hand-embroidered; the beds are dressed with cotton sheets, large, square
feather pillows and traditional pure woollen blankets.
Every room has an antique desk or writing table with conveniently placed
power and telecommunication sockets; most rooms also have a separate table
enabling you to enjoy Room Service without disturbing your work.
The bathrooms have traditional Victorian-style fittings combined with
a lavish use of warm limestone, whilst behind the scenes we have excellent
modern plumbing with pressurised hot and cold water. With every room also
having air conditioning, you will enjoy the peace and quiet - and comfort
- of The Cranley.
